Housing New Zealand recently engaged Envivo to assist in the redevelopment of 139 Greys Avenue, central Auckland. Envivo is providing all the civil engineering work for this urban regeneration project. Our civil engineers are working closely with a wider team of engineers and architects to develop the water, stormwater and wastewater services for this innovative new urban village. In addition to this our structural engineering team is providing peer review services to the contract.
Significant site challenges had to be overcome during the civil works design due to the size of the new building’s footprint within the site and its proximity to the boundary where existing services are situated. CCTV investigation was used to assist in the stormwater and wastewater network design.
When completed 139 Greys Avenue will provide 200 new state homes and 76 non state homes in an innovative building and living environment.
